About The Role
An Application Specialist is responsible for analysing, designing, and deployment of configuration changes within the council's core applications. This role works closely with business users to understand their needs, identify gaps in existing systems, and develop solutions that address those gaps. They also ensure that software applications are properly tested and deployed, and they provide ongoing support to users.

About You.
The successful candidate will be required to:

  • Providing technical support and troubleshooting services for software applications, including identifying and resolving issues related to software functionality, configuration, and integration.
  • Collaborating with end-users to understand their needs and develop solutions to address their requirements.
  • Working closely with software vendors to identify and resolve bugs and other issues.
  • Deploying configuration changes across development, test and production environments whilst adhering to councils change management procedure.
  • Developing and conducting end-user training to ensure that users are able to use the software effectively.
  • Conduct regular assessments of software applications to identify areas for improvement and optimise performance.
  • Developing and maintaining documentation for software applications, including user manuals and technical documentation.
  • Managing software version control and ensuring that software is kept up to date with the latest patches and updates.
  • Monitoring system performance and addressing issues related to performance and scalability.
  • Participating in software development projects as needed, providing guidance on software functionality and technical requirements.
  • Providing recommendations for new software applications and technologies that could improve business operations and efficiency.
  • Deliver high levels of service that meet or exceed agreed SLA's.
